commit: 00e03db6d9f01bcd735520a3dbfee2ac02683b65
Author: Mike Gilbert <floppym <AT> gentoo <DOT> org>
AuthorDate: Sat Mar 14 20:32:47 2026 +0000
Commit: Mike Gilbert <floppym <AT> gentoo <DOT> org>
CommitDate: Sat Mar 14 21:11:46 2026 +0000
URL: https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=00e03db6
sys-apps/systemd: enable nss-myhostname and nss-systemd explicitly
Signed-off-by: Mike Gilbert <floppym <AT> gentoo.org>
sys-apps/systemd/systemd-260_rc4.ebuild | 2 ++
sys-apps/systemd/systemd-9999.ebuild | 2 ++
2 files changed, 4 insertions(+)
diff --git a/sys-apps/systemd/systemd-260_rc4.ebuild
b/sys-apps/systemd/systemd-260_rc4.ebuild
index 96196e5b81d9..8a81a2c1dcbb 100644
--- a/sys-apps/systemd/systemd-260_rc4.ebuild
+++ b/sys-apps/systemd/systemd-260_rc4.ebuild
@@ -292,8 +292,10 @@ multilib_src_configure() {
-Dcompat-mutable-uid-boundaries=true
# options affecting multilib
+ $(meson_use !elibc_musl nss-myhostname)
$(meson_feature !elibc_musl nss-mymachines)
$(meson_feature !elibc_musl nss-resolve)
+ $(meson_use !elibc_musl nss-systemd)
$(meson_feature pam)
)
diff --git a/sys-apps/systemd/systemd-9999.ebuild
b/sys-apps/systemd/systemd-9999.ebuild
index 96196e5b81d9..8a81a2c1dcbb 100644
--- a/sys-apps/systemd/systemd-9999.ebuild
+++ b/sys-apps/systemd/systemd-9999.ebuild
@@ -292,8 +292,10 @@ multilib_src_configure() {
-Dcompat-mutable-uid-boundaries=true
# options affecting multilib
+ $(meson_use !elibc_musl nss-myhostname)
$(meson_feature !elibc_musl nss-mymachines)
$(meson_feature !elibc_musl nss-resolve)
+ $(meson_use !elibc_musl nss-systemd)
$(meson_feature pam)
)